+## vm-bhyve Policy on f3
+
+`rocky` is the default VM on f3:
+
+```sh
+doas sysrc vm_list="rocky"
+doas sysrc vm_delay="5"
+```
+
+The older FreeBSD development VM on f3 should remain stopped by default:
+
+```sh
+doas vm list
+# freebsd ... AUTO No Stopped
+# rocky ... AUTO Yes Running
+```
+
+Do not add `freebsd` back to `vm_list` unless the desired boot policy changes.
+
+## VM Config
+
+Config path on f3:
+
+```text
+/zroot/bhyve/rocky/rocky.conf
+```
+
+Expected config shape:
+
+```conf
+loader="uefi"
+uefi_vars="yes"
+guest="linux"
+cpu=4
+memory=14G
+network0_type="virtio-net"
+network0_switch="public"
+disk0_type="nvme"
+disk0_name="disk0.img"
+graphics="yes"
+graphics_vga=io
+graphics_wait="no"
+uuid="<unique>"
+network0_mac="<unique>"
+```
+
+Disk:
+
+```text
+/zroot/bhyve/rocky/disk0.img
+100G sparse file
+NVMe emulation
+```
